At the meeting with Mr. Akio Yoshida, Executive Chairman of AEON Group, Prime Minister Pham Minh Chinh highly appreciated AEON's positive and effective contributions to the development of the retail and export sectors in Vietnam.

According to the Prime Minister, Vietnam has 5 important fundamental factors that AEON and other investors can expand their investment and business in Vietnam: Vietnam identifies consumption as a growth driver; has a market of more than 100 million people, a young population and a growing number of middle-class people, striving to become a country with an upper middle income by 2030; Vietnam-Japan relations are increasingly developing well; Japanese goods are popular with Vietnamese people; Vietnamese goods are abundant, with strengths in food, foodstuffs, textiles, footwear, etc. and are being greened, in line with the general consumption trend of the world .

The Prime Minister suggested that AEON Group choose Vietnam as its business base in the world. AEON Group continues to invest in more shopping centers and Outlet areas in suburban areas, combining shopping with entertainment; investing in building shopping centers not only in Hanoi, Ho Chi Minh City, Hai Phong, Thua Thien Hue, Can Tho, Thanh Hoa as at present but also expanding to provinces and cities with high per capita income, large population, and service and tourism centers such as: Quang Ninh, Ba Ria-Vung Tau, Thai Nguyen, Nghe An, Tay Nguyen, Khanh Hoa, An Giang...

The Prime Minister also asked AEON to increase imports, bringing Vietnamese goods into the global supply chain, especially products in which Vietnam has strengths such as: footwear, seafood, food. Vietnam is building brands for products; investing in synchronous logistics services, creating favorable conditions, reducing costs for products. In particular, he asked AEON Group to grant scholarships to students and participate in training human resources for Vietnam.

Mr. Akio Yoshida, Executive Chairman of AEON Group, said that so far Vietnam is the country where AEON has invested the most in the world, with more than 1.18 billion USD. AEON has opened 6 shopping centers in major cities and provinces of Vietnam such as Hanoi, Ho Chi Minh City, Hai Phong, Thua Thien Hue, etc.

Agreeing with the opinions of Prime Minister Pham Minh Chinh, in the coming time, AEON will develop about 20 shopping malls in Vietnam, focusing on supermarket and entertainment business. In addition, the Group will also expand the import of Vietnamese goods for distribution in more than 20,000 shopping malls in Japan. AEON will also provide scholarships to support Vietnam in human resource training.

* On the same morning, Prime Minister Pham Minh Chinh had a working session with Professor Mitsuo Ochi, President of Hiroshima University, Mr. Matsumoko Kazuhisa, General Director of Satake Group, Mr. Yamassaka Tetsuro, Chairman of Balcom Group and leaders of 07 enterprises in the Central-Southern region of Japan.

On behalf of the delegation, Prof. Mitsuo Ochi, President of Hiroshima University, discussed promoting cooperation in the fields of education, human resource training, smart urban development, carbon neutrality, semiconductor development, digital agriculture, livestock farming, building rice production standards, responding to drought, saltwater intrusion, etc.

He hopes to continue receiving support from the Government, ministries, sectors and localities of Vietnam to organize business delegations to explore investment opportunities and promote cooperation in these areas. He also highly appreciated Vietnamese students studying abroad as well as Vietnam's human resources in general, saying that so far, 343 Vietnamese people have graduated from the school.

The Prime Minister welcomed the cooperation activities of Hiroshima University with Vietnam in the field of human resource training - one of Vietnam's strategic breakthroughs; as well as the cooperation activities of enterprises in the Central and Southern regions of Japan with Vietnam in recent times, especially in the fields in which Japan has experience and strengths, and Vietnam has demand and potential.

Vietnam and Japan are celebrating the 50th anniversary of diplomatic relations, in the context of the two countries' relationship being at its best ever, based on the extensive strategic partnership and the tradition of exchange and cooperation dating back hundreds of years. In recent times, the number of Vietnamese people in Japan has increased rapidly, now reaching nearly 500,000 people.

The Prime Minister affirmed that the two governments always support cooperation activities between the two countries, including cooperation activities between enterprises, which are increasingly practical and effective. The Prime Minister highly appreciated the initiative of Hiroshima University and enterprises in the Central-Southern region of Japan to promote cooperation with Vietnam in the coming time, especially in the fields of agriculture, training, human resource development, digital transformation, green transformation, climate change response, knowledge economy, circular economy, private hospitals, etc. The Prime Minister hoped that Hiroshima University would research and open training facilities and branches in Vietnam.

The Prime Minister asked businesses in the Central-Southern region of Japan to continue to closely coordinate with the Vietnamese Embassy in Japan, the Vietnamese Consulate General in Fukuoka and relevant ministries, sectors and agencies to soon realize cooperation and investment ideas, contributing to promoting the extensive strategic partnership between the two countries to become increasingly deeper, more substantial and effective.

The Government pledges to support and create favorable conditions for Japanese enterprises in general and enterprises in the Central-Southern region of Japan in particular in the process of cooperation and investment in Vietnam./.
